As a Flight Attendant, you are responsible for ensuring that the safety of all passengers is a priority. What would you do if you felt there was a safety threat?

Airlines will always have strict safety protocols, and your interviewer is curious how competently you would react in a situation where you felt safety was at risk. Familiarize yourself with the detailed Southwest Airlines Safety & Security Commitment. It will inform you of their responsibilities and commitments. "Southwest Airlines is committed to ensuring the Safety and Security of our customers and employees. It's our number one priority. We continually work to create and foster a Culture of Safety and Security that proactively identifies and manages risks to the operation and workplace before they can become injuries, accidents, or incidents."

      1st Answer Example

      "My reaction to a safety threat would rely on my on-the-job training. I would follow company protocol and safety regulations. I believe that, if faced with a safety threat, I would do everything to ensure passengers remained calm."

      2nd Answer Example

      "I am well trained to react in urgent, distressed, and mayday situations. In any emergency, my first course of action is to ensure the passengers are prepared."
